Crawlspace Waterproofing in Tuscaloosa, AL
Crawlspace waterproofing services focus on preventing water intrusion and moisture buildup beneath a property, which can lead to structural damage, mold growth, and poor indoor air quality. These projects typically involve installing vapor barriers, sealing foundation cracks, and implementing drainage systems to redirect water away from the foundation. Property owners often seek this service when they notice signs of excess moisture, musty odors, or water pooling in the crawlspace, aiming to protect their home’s foundation and improve indoor air conditions.

Common Crawlspace Waterproofing Jobs
Basement Crawlspace Waterproofing - helps prevent moisture build-up that can lead to mold growth.
Vapor Barrier Installation - seals the crawlspace to reduce humidity and improve air quality.
Drainage System Setup - directs water away from the foundation to prevent flooding and damage.
Sealant and Encapsulation - protects the crawlspace from leaks and keeps pests out.
Dehumidification Solutions - controls moisture levels for a healthier indoor environment.
Foundation Crack Repair - addresses structural issues that can cause water intrusion.
Crawlspace Waterproofing Questions
What is crawlspace waterproofing? It involves sealing and protecting the crawlspace to prevent water intrusion and moisture buildup that can lead to damage and mold.
Why is waterproofing important for a crawlspace? Proper waterproofing helps maintain a dry environment, reducing the risk of structural issues and improving indoor air quality.
What types of issues can waterproofing address? It can resolve problems like standing water, excess humidity, mold growth, and wood rot in the crawlspace area.
How does waterproofing improve a home's foundation? It creates a barrier against moisture that can weaken the foundation, helping to preserve stability and prevent future damage.
